“Athos – Home of Faith” travels to Asenovgrad

You’re invited to the exhibition “ATHOS – Home of Faith”—an encounter with the silence, spiritual depth, and timeless beauty of the Holy Mountain.
Through drawings and photographs created during more than 50 journeys to Mount Athos, artist Andrey Yanev and photographer Prof. Miroslav Dachev reveal a place hidden from many—a world of prayer, humility, and centuries-old spiritual traditions.

Celebrating Antarctica Day with first closed screening of “Lame Dog of Antarctica”

On 1 December, the world marks the signing of the Antarctic Treaty (1959)—an international agreement that turns the continent into a place of science, peace, and cooperation. This year the celebration was even more special for us, because we held a closed first screening of our animated film “The Lame Dog of Antarctica,” and the audience welcomed it with tremendous enthusiasm!

“Athos in Drawings and Photographs” is visiting Athens

We are pleased to invite you to the exceptional exhibition “Athos in Drawings and Photographs,” organized by Dekidis Films in collaboration with the Embassy of the Republic of Bulgaria in Athens. The exhibition will be held from November 21 to December 4, 2025, at the Museum of Byzantine and Christian Art, Vasilissis Sofias Ave 22, Athens.

Shooting Wraps for “The Lame Dog Of Antarctica”

We’ve completed production on “The Lame Dog of Antarctica,” an inspiring animated short film that explores the journey of the first explorers on the Ice Continent, highlighting Bulgaria’s role through Prof. Hristo Pimpirev. Designed for children aged 7 to 11, the film is now entering its final post-production phase and will debut at international festivals this summer!
